
Emmy grew up in Lennox, SD and currently resides in Clear Lake, SD with her husband (Jim), daughters (Baylie and Kylie), and her three step children (Ashley, Caden, and Carson). In high school, Emmy played softball, golf, and wrestled. She has loved playing football as a way to keep active and be competitive. She loves being part of a team and continues to build on her football skill sets.
In 2022 (her rookie year with the Snow Leopards), Emmy was starting Defensive End and a significant contributor on Special Teams, lending her the nickname “The Enforcer”. She lead our Division in fumble recoveries, and she finished the season #16 (D3) for Tackles. In 2023, she saw time at Defensive End as well as Center and was also the starting Kicker. In 2024, she was the starting Defensive Tackle and earned 3rd Team WFA All-American honors. She was also a reliable and effective starting kicker and saw reps on offense at Running Back. Emmy is now in her fourth year with the Snow Leopards and looks to see time at Running Back and Linebacker. She’s a true defensive stop Enforcer, and we’re proud to call her our teammate.
